Output fed6381e212fce703c0ae70c3d576d16d02beaccb0ae9cc6c08c02cf18bee326:144

value
39858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f7fbf08d23aba328c9694c0c9c112ffa7ec5d1 OP_EQUAL
address
34EuExpayoENV4t9LoG45puk89WsLY7b69
transaction
fed6381e212fce703c0ae70c3d576d16d02beaccb0ae9cc6c08c02cf18bee326
spent
true